On the MCN site this morning:

TiVo Flips On Android Streaming
Complements Capabilities Already Offered On iOS Devices

By Jeff Baumgartner, Multichannel News - September 30, 2014
»www.multichannel.com/new ··· g/384285
quote:
TiVo is covering its mobile bases Tuesday with the launch of streaming for Android-powered devices (»blog.tivo.com/2014/09/to ··· th-tivo/)

TiVo’s updated app, initially offered at Google Play and coming to the Amazon App Store “in a few days,” will enable users of the company's Roamio DVR lineup (including models that don’t have on-board transcoding and need to be paired with the Slingbox-like TiVo Stream sidecar device) to stream recorded or live shows on their Android devices when they are in or out of the home using WiFi or LTE/4G connections.
